Find the rate of change of the function f(x)=2^x + 7 over the interval [1,4]. Round to the nearest tenth

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]rate ~of~change=\frac{f(4)-f(1)}{4-1} \\f(4)=2^4+7=23\\f(1)=2^1+7=9\\rate ~of~change=\frac{23-9}{3} \\=\frac{14}{3} \\\approx 4.7[/tex]
